摘要
本发明公开了一种Rectangle中间相遇攻击密码分析方法及系统,属于信息安全对称密码设计与分析技术领域,方法包括:获取数据加密机的分组加密算法;基于加密算法构建Rectangle区分器;基于输入、输出差分特征对Rectangle区分器两端进行差分扩展,基于差分计算攻击所需的数据量后,选择消息进行攻击;遍历扩展部分的密钥,将明文送入扩展部分,将差分进行比对并组建数据对,使用数据对组建前向四元组,同时将密文送入后向扩展部分进行解密,构建后向四元组;对四元组取交集,得到匹配结果;根据匹配结果得到部分密钥信息,使用穷搜法获取剩余的密钥信息,得到数据加密机的完整密钥,得到分析结果。
技术关键词
密码分析方法
密钥
密码分析系统
明文
分组加密算法
数据加密
解密密文
哈希表
子模块
扩展模块
加密机
匹配模块
终点
总量
消息
系统为您推荐了相关专利信息
非对称加密算法
LED灯珠
真实性验证
密钥
标记